Find hotels in Sospel using the list and search tools below. Find cheap and/or discounted hotel rates in or near Sospel, France for your corporate or personal leisure travel. Discover the most popular Sospel hotel and motel rooms. Browse the Sospel area hotels to find the perfect lodging! Please use the provided map of the Sospel hotels.